Force India duo delighted with points double

Force India drivers Adrian Sutil and Paul di Resta were in high spirits following the Australian Grand Prix in Melbourne on Sunday, with the pair recording the team's first double points finish since Formula 1's visit to Spa-Francorchamps last September. Sutil, who led the race on numerous occasions with a unique tyre strategy, ultimately claimed seventh after a troublesome late stint on the Super Soft rubber, while team-mate di Resta backed up a strong qualifying result to finish the race in eighth.
